Archery's book for beginners are the building blocks of consistent shooting. Expert and beginner archers rely on these basics to make clutch shots in leagues and at major tournaments. These basics consist of stance, grip, posture, bow arm, anchor point, release and follow-through. If you master the basics you're on your way to becoming an excellent shot. This book will guide you through the key parts of archery form; stance, grip, finger position, preparing the shot, drawing the bow, anchoring, aiming, loosing and follow through. This book includes: Chapter 1 The Basic first, warm up Chapter 2 Stance, the feet Chapter 3 The pre-draw, nock the arrow Chapter 4 Common problems, frustration This is the best place to start for beginners and for those wishing to improve their form and find consistency in finding the center of the target.
